Cost

The cost of an ADHD assessment can vary greatly. It is contingent on the person who conducts the evaluation and whether you have any neuropsychological tests conducted. The cost may also be affected by your insurance coverage. Certain private insurers will cover all or a portion of the cost of an ADHD assessment. Before making an appointment, it's crucial to confirm your insurance coverage. Certain companies permit you to pay in installments to cover the cost of the examination which makes it more affordable.

The first step of determining if you suffer from ADHD is to consult with your psychiatrist or doctor. This can be done in person or via phone or video conference. You will be asked to bring a written list of your symptoms along with your medical history and any previous assessments. Your doctor will also interview you and ask how your ADHD symptoms affect your daily life. You will be asked to describe your symptoms and the impact they've affected your professional and personal relationships.

Your GP may refer you to a specialist who can examine your ADHD. This could be a lengthy process. In some cases you might have to wait for months to be assessed. Private clinics are a great option if you suffer from symptoms of ADHD and want to start treatment sooner. These clinics can be costly. It is recommended to choose a provider that offers a shared-care arrangement with your GP so you only pay the NHS prescription fee.

Another option for obtaining an ADHD assessment is to reach out to a mental health organization like ADDUK. The charity will provide you with an acknowledgement letter that you can present to your doctor in order to convince him to refer you for an ADHD assessment. You can also try to find an independent psychologist who specialises in adult ADHD.

You can also locate an ADHD specialist online. Many websites provide a range of services, from ADHD screening to therapy for adults suffering from ADHD. These sites are not controlled, but they must follow the National Institute for Clinical Excellence guidelines for ADHD treatment. You should also make sure that the professional you're dealing with is a registered member of the General Medical Council and on their specialist register.

Time to wait

ADHD is a complex disorder and it can be difficult for adults to be diagnosed. Certain patients have to wait for years before they are able to be diagnosed with ADHD. This has grave implications for mental health. Undiagnosed ADHD may result in anxiety, depression and abuse of substances. It can make people more prone to suicide. It can also increase the chance of road accidents and other medical illnesses. Moreover, people with ADHD are five times more likely to attempt suicide than the general population.

Adults can be given an ADHD diagnosis through the NHS by going to their GP. However, waiting times can be very long, and some choose to seek Private ADHD assessment Hampshire treatment. These services are usually offered at hospitals and wellness centres. These centers are staffed by specialists who can evaluate adults for ADHD. The process of assessment takes into account your past and present symptoms. You will be asked to assess your symptoms in various social situations and at different stages of your life. In addition, the specialist will examine your body language and observe your speech. The expert will ask you about your family history, as well as any medical conditions that you may have.

If you've been diagnosed with ADHD, you can be prescribed medication by your GP. But, you must be aware that this could cost extra. You may not be able receive the same medication as prescribed by your GP in the case of a private diagnosis. In the UK it could be a problem because certain pharmacies are not able to prescribe ADHD medication to those with private diagnoses.

The time required to complete an ADHD assessment is determined by various factors. The first is the quality of the assessment. It is important for the evaluation to follow guidelines established by the National Institute of Heath and Care Excellence. Second, it is important that the person who is performing the evaluation has experience diagnosing ADHD.

An investigation conducted by the BBC's Panorama show has revealed that a number of private clinics do not provide reliable tests for adhd private assessment ireland. The undercover reporter was diagnosed with ADHD at three different private adhd assessment ireland adult clinics. This raised concerns that people may be misdiagnosed, leading to them being given powerful drugs for long-term use without the proper guidance regarding side effects.

Qualifications

If you suspect that you suffer from ADHD, it's important to see a specialist. A doctor may recommend an NHS assessment, or you can search for a private provider which offers ADHD assessments. Psychiatrists and specialist ADHD nurses can test you for the condition. The tests involve taking a mental note and performing tests like the Conners Rating Scale in order to assess the severity of your symptoms. They will also talk with you about how your symptoms impact your life and relationships. These assessments will help you determine whether you require medication or therapy.

Getting an ADHD diagnosis as an adult can be challenging since medical professionals have preconceived notions about what people suffering from the condition appear like. This can make it difficult to identify your symptoms even if they are causing significant issues in your work and social life. The good news is the stigma around ADHD is changing. There are a variety of resources available to people who are seeking the correct diagnosis.

A psychiatrist or consultant psychiatrist is the best choice to diagnose ADHD. These specialists have the qualifications and experience to identify the disorder and prescribe medication. They can also check for other mental health conditions which could be the cause of your symptoms.

There are solutions in the event that your GP refuses to refer you for a ADHD assessment. You can print an email from ADHD UK and hand it to your GP, or you can request them to refer you to the NICE guidelines (NHS 87).

If you're looking for an effective treatment plan, it's recommended to speak with a medical professional. A specialist will provide an extensive assessment and examine the impact of your symptoms on your daily functioning, relationships, and work performance. They may employ a mix of different methods to determine whether you suffer from ADHD and include blood tests and imaging.

In addition you can ask for a shared care agreement with your GP in the event that you're diagnosed with ADHD. This will save you money on the cost of prescriptions, but not all GPs will be willing to accept this, so be sure to confirm with them before booking an appointment.
